Career Role Description
Bioinformatics Scientist (Protein Prediction) Develops and applies computational methods for protein function prediction; high demand in pharmaceutical research.
Computational Biologist (Protein Structure) Focuses on protein structure prediction and its relation to function, using advanced algorithms and machine learning; crucial for drug discovery.
Data Scientist (Proteomics) Analyzes large proteomics datasets to identify protein functions and interactions; critical role in biotechnology.
Research Scientist (Protein Engineering) Designs and engineers proteins with improved or novel functions using prediction tools; vital for industrial biotechnology.
